The Rivers State House of Assembly led by Martin Amaewhule has issued a 7-day ultimatum to Governor Siminalayi Fubara to respect the rule of law and re-present the 2024 budget to the House.

 

In a statement after a sitting today, a member of the house, Enemi George stated that the budget presentation before the Edison Ehie led assembly was not in accordance with constitution, insisting that the present assembly is the legally recognised law-making arm of the state.

 

 

Although Fubara had presented an appropriation bill of about N800 billion for the 2024 Fiscal year to the Edison Ehie, George said the court ruling has nullified all action taken under that arrangement, including appointments of commissioners and local government caretaker committee.

 

Meanwhile, the Victor Oko-Jumbo-led assembly loyal to Governor Fubara held a parallel sitting wherein a commissioner nominee was screened and confirmed for possible swearing.
